This 200-ft roll of gray DBCI-style blade weatherstrip is used to replace worn, cracked, missing, or damaged bottom seal on compatible roll-up doors. This profile is used on DBCI M640 doors and other compatible self-storage, mini-warehouse, and overhead doors that use an equivalent 3/8" T-style blade seal.

The 3/8" T-style mount fits into the bottom seal retainer, while the 1" blade profile helps close the gap between the bottom of the door and the floor or threshold. The 200-ft roll is a practical option for maintenance teams, contractors, and facilities replacing seal across multiple doors or cutting custom lengths in the field. This seal is made in the USA.

Installation Notes

  • Remove the old bottom seal and clean dirt or debris from the retainer before installing the new seal.
  • Check the retainer for crushed, bent, or pinched areas and straighten as needed.
  • Cut the new seal slightly longer than needed, then trim to final length after installation.
  • If needed, use a small amount of plastic-safe, non-staining lubricant in the retainer to help the seal slide through the track.
  • Keep lubricants away from visible painted surfaces, hasps, latch areas, and any areas that may be repainted later.
  • Avoid pulling with excessive force, which may stretch or damage the seal.
  • Lightly crimp the track ends if needed to help reduce seal movement after installation.
